Building a modern digital ecosystem requires a deep understanding of the underlying blockchain network infrastructure that supports decentralized applications and distributed ledgers. This foundational layer is responsible for maintaining the integrity, speed, and security of every transaction recorded on the chain. Whether you are an enterprise developer or a tech enthusiast, mastering the nuances of this infrastructure is the first step toward creating scalable and resilient blockchain solutions.
The Core Components of Blockchain Network Infrastructure
At its heart, blockchain network infrastructure consists of several interconnected layers that work in harmony to achieve consensus. These layers include the physical hardware, the networking protocols, and the software clients that run on individual nodes. Without a robust physical layer, the decentralized nature of the network would be compromised, leading to potential bottlenecks or security vulnerabilities.
The hardware requirements for blockchain network infrastructure vary significantly depending on the consensus mechanism used. For example, Proof of Work (PoW) networks demand high-performance ASIC miners or GPUs, while Proof of Stake (PoS) networks focus more on high uptime, memory, and storage capacity. Selecting the right hardware ensures that the node can handle the computational load and keep up with the increasing size of the ledger.
The Role of Nodes and Peer-to-Peer Networking
Nodes are the individual computers that make up the blockchain network infrastructure. Each node maintains a copy of the blockchain and communicates with other nodes via a peer-to-peer (P2P) protocol. This decentralized communication model ensures that there is no single point of failure, making the network highly resistant to censorship and outages.
- Full Nodes: These store the entire history of the blockchain and validate all transactions and blocks.
- Light Nodes: These store only the headers of blocks and rely on full nodes for verification, making them ideal for mobile devices.
- Validator Nodes: In PoS systems, these nodes are responsible for proposing and voting on new blocks.
- Archive Nodes: These store every state change in the history of the network, which is essential for data analysis and block explorers.
Ensuring Security within the Infrastructure
Security is the most critical aspect of any blockchain network infrastructure. Because these networks often handle high-value assets, they are frequent targets for malicious actors. Implementing a multi-layered security strategy is essential to protect the integrity of the data and the availability of the service.
Firewalls, intrusion detection systems, and secure key management are standard requirements for any node operator. Furthermore, the blockchain network infrastructure must be designed to withstand Distributed Denial of Service (DDoS) attacks, which can temporarily paralyze a network by overwhelming its nodes with traffic. Distributed hosting across multiple geographic regions and cloud providers can help mitigate these risks.
The Importance of Low Latency and High Bandwidth
As blockchain adoption grows, the demand for high-performance blockchain network infrastructure increases. Latency—the time it takes for data to travel between nodes—can significantly impact the speed of block propagation. If a network has high latency, it increases the risk of “forks,” where two different blocks are mined at the same time, leading to temporary instability.
High bandwidth is equally important, especially for networks with large block sizes or high transaction throughput. A robust blockchain network infrastructure must be able to transmit large amounts of data quickly across the globe. Professional node operators often use dedicated fiber optic connections and optimized routing protocols to ensure their infrastructure remains competitive and reliable.
Scalability Challenges in Modern Architectures
One of the biggest hurdles for blockchain network infrastructure is scalability. As more users join the network, the volume of data grows exponentially. This can lead to increased storage costs and slower synchronization times for new nodes. To combat this, many developers are looking toward Layer 2 solutions and sharding.
Sharding involves breaking the blockchain into smaller, more manageable pieces called “shards.” Each shard has its own set of nodes, which reduces the burden on the overall blockchain network infrastructure. Layer 2 solutions, such as state channels and rollups, move transaction processing off the main chain, significantly increasing throughput while maintaining the security of the underlying layer.
Cloud vs. On-Premise Infrastructure
Choosing between cloud-based and on-premise solutions is a major decision for anyone setting up blockchain network infrastructure. Cloud providers offer flexibility, easy scaling, and geographic diversity. However, relying too heavily on a single cloud provider can lead to centralization, which goes against the core principles of blockchain technology.
- Cloud Hosting: Fast deployment, managed services, and high availability but potentially higher long-term costs.
- On-Premise: Full control over hardware and security, lower long-term costs, but requires significant technical expertise and physical space.
- Hybrid Models: Combining both cloud and on-premise resources to balance control with scalability.
Future Trends in Blockchain Infrastructure
The future of blockchain network infrastructure is moving toward greater interoperability and energy efficiency. We are seeing a shift away from energy-intensive mining toward more sustainable consensus models. Additionally, cross-chain bridges are becoming a standard part of the infrastructure, allowing different blockchain networks to communicate and share data seamlessly.
Artificial Intelligence is also beginning to play a role in optimizing blockchain network infrastructure. AI algorithms can be used to predict network congestion, optimize data routing, and even detect anomalous behavior that might indicate a security breach. As these technologies mature, the infrastructure supporting our decentralized future will become even more resilient and efficient.
Conclusion and Next Steps
Investing time and resources into a high-quality blockchain network infrastructure is essential for the success of any decentralized project. By understanding the hardware, networking, and security requirements, you can build a system that is not only fast and reliable but also truly decentralized. As the technology continues to evolve, staying informed about new scaling solutions and security practices will be key to maintaining a competitive edge.
Ready to take your project to the next level? Begin by auditing your current setup and identifying potential bottlenecks in your blockchain network infrastructure. Whether you choose to upgrade your hardware or migrate to a more efficient consensus model, the decisions you make today will define the stability of your network for years to come.